This album, released on August 1, 2011, under the Chamber Sound label, showcases Bacewicz's mastery of the violin through two of her most notable works: the Sonata No. 2 for violin solo and the Violin Sonata No. 4.
The album opens with "Kaprys polski" (Polish Capriccio), setting the tone for a journey through Bacewicz's neoclassical compositions. The Sonata No. 2 for violin solo is a testament to her skill in writing for the instrument, featuring four movements that range from the contemplative "Adagio" to the energetic "Presto." The Violin Sonata No. 4, performed with Benedicte Haid, is a four-movement work that highlights Bacewicz's ability to blend technical virtuosity with emotional depth.
This collection also includes other notable pieces such as "Oberek No. 1," "Kołysanka" (Lullaby), and "4 Kaprysy" (4 Caprices), each offering a unique glimpse into Bacewicz's versatile compositional style. Grażyna Bacewicz, born in Łódź in 1909, was a pioneering figure in Polish music, renowned for her dual prowess as a composer and violinist. Hailing from a musically inclined, polish-litewische family, Bacewicz's early exposure to music laid the foundation for her illustrious career. She studied at the Warsaw Conservatory, where she honed her skills under the guidance of esteemed mentors. Her compositions, rooted in the neoclassical genre, reflect her deep understanding and mastery of musical form and structure. Bacewicz's work is celebrated for its technical brilliance and emotional depth, earning her a place among the most notable composers of the 20th century.
